GPCR - Arrestin interface interactions
The biflare plot is a modified version of a flareplot, where lines are drawn between an inner concentric circle
(arrestin residues)
and an outer concentric circle (GPCR residues) depicting the interface interactions.
Different interaction types are shown with different line types (aromatic - solid,
hydrophobic - dashed,
ionic - long dashed, polar - dotted, Van der Waals - dash-dot).
The interactive features include filtering on interaction type, segments, residues and backbone or sidechain interactions.
